Class XarBzip2CompressionSettings

Class XarBzip2CompressionSettings

Namespace: Aspose.Zip.Xar
Assembly: Aspose.Zip.dll (25.1.0)

Einstellungen für die Bzip2-Komprimierungsmethode.

public class XarBzip2CompressionSettings : XarCompressionSettings

Vererbung

objectXarCompressionSettingsXarBzip2CompressionSettings

Vererbte Mitglieder

object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()

Konstruktoren

XarBzip2CompressionSettings(int)

Initialisiert eine neue Instanz der Aspose.Zip.Xar.XarBzip2CompressionSettings-Klasse.

public XarBzip2CompressionSettings(int blockSize)

Parameter

blockSize int

Blockgröße in Hunderten von Kilobytes.

Beispiele

using (XarArchive archive = new XarArchive())
{
    archive.CreateEntry("data.bin", "data.bin", new XarBzip2CompressionSettings(1));
    archive.Save("archive.xar");
}

Ausnahmen

ArgumentOutOfRangeException

Die Blockgröße liegt nicht zwischen 1 und 9.

XarBzip2CompressionSettings()

Initialisiert eine neue Instanz der Aspose.Zip.Xar.XarBzip2CompressionSettings-Klasse mit der Standardblockgröße, die 9 Hunderten von Kilobytes entspricht.

public XarBzip2CompressionSettings()

Eigenschaften

BlockSize

Blockgröße in Hunderten von Kilobytes.

public int BlockSize { get; }

Eigenschaftswert

int

 Deutsch